The Toronto International Film Festival, often considered the unofficial launch of the Oscar season, kicks off tomorrow. The festival, now in its 40th year, offers a first look at many of the movies that will be vying for Academy Awards next year.

The line-up includes feature films starring Jake Gyllenhaal, Eddie Redmayne, Benedict Cumberbatch and Julianne Moore.
